Find the moment of inertia of a thin uniform rod about an axis perpendicular to its length and passing through a point which is at a distance of `1/3` from one end. Also find radius of gyration about that axis.

Let P be the point at a distance `l/3` from one end . It is distance of `(l/2-l/3)=l/6` from the centre as shown in the figure .

By parallel axes theorem `I = I_(c ) +Mr^(2)`
`(Ml^(2))/(12) + M(l/6)^(2) = (Ml^(2))/9`
(ii) The radius of gyration
`K = sqrt(I/M)= sqrt((Ml^(2))/(9M)) = l/3 `
